alongside

1 of 2

adverb

along·​side ə-ˈlȯŋ-ˈsīd How to pronounce alongside (audio)
1
: along the side : in parallel position
2
: at the side : close by
a guard with a prisoner alongside

alongside

2 of 2

preposition

1
a
: along the side of
the boat docked alongside the pier
b
: beside sense 1
standing alongside me
2
a
: in company with
men she has been working alongsideRichard Halloran
b
: in addition to
a special category alongside the awards it annually presentsHorizon

Examples of alongside in a Sentence

Adverb We waited for the other boat to come alongside. Preposition The children work alongside their parents in the field. Bring the boat alongside the dock. one theory taught alongside the other The town grew up alongside the college.

Word History

First Known Use

Adverb

1704, in the meaning defined at sense 1

Preposition

1704, in the meaning defined at sense 1a

Time Traveler
The first known use of alongside was in 1704
